转运RNA(tRNA)是将信使RNA(mRNA)翻译成蛋白质的关键分子,研究表明它还是一些非编码小RNA的前体RNA。近年来,人们发现在细菌、真菌、植物和动物中存在一些长约16~60 nts的非编码RNA(ncRNA),它们是由tRNA精确剪切而来的片段(tRF),并非是随机降解的产物。目前人们对这类小分子RNA的认识还很有限,近年的研究表明tRF在各种疾病中具有重要的功能。本文针对tRF的分类、修饰及其在各种疾病中的作用及机制等研究进展进行综述。“,”Transfer RNA (tRNA) is a key molecule in translating mRNA into proteins, and studies have shown that it is also a precursor RNA for some non-coding small RNAs. In recent years, it has been shown that some non-coding RNAs (ncRNAs) about 16-60nts derived from tRNA are expressed in bacteria, fungi, plants and animals, which are precisely cleaved by endonuclease and not the product of random degradation. There is still limited understanding of these small molecules of RNA. In recent years, studies have shown that these small RNAs have important functions in various diseases. This paper summarizes the classification, modification, the role and mechanism of tRNA-derived fragments in various diseases.
